Well the EM has run its course and the better team won, Spain. Watching the game last night with my neighbors was, again, an insight into how different cultures see things, or better put, react to things differently. As soon as things started going less than perfect in the game for the German side, my neighbors began to criticize the team. It started slow at first until it became an outright tirade about the inability of the players to do anything right. By halftime, an overwhelming sense of hopelessness had crept over all of us. This attitude I saw, was reflected by the faces of the German fans in the crowd in Vienna.

This shouldn’t have surprised me. After all, I’m aware of the German’s overly critical views on things and I have a general understand that this is base upon the fear of failure. But it did strike me as strange, despite any fore knowledge I might have had. At one point, of our neighbors remarked, “the Spanish fans would be trying to fire-up their team at a time like this. But look at us. We can’t help it, we’re Germans.”
